4.1.9.2

2009-01-13 Thread Maxim Masiutin
The Bat! 4.1.9.2 is available at
http://www.ritlabs.com/download/files3/the_bat/beta/tb4192.rar

What's new in 4.1.9.2 since 4.1.9.1:
[-] West European characters with accents were lost in HTML Quick templates
[-] Fixed the %WINDOWSPLATFORMNAME% macro for Windows 7 and Windows 2008 
Server
[-] The hints in the status bar were blinking.
[*] Then the text in the tabs is longer than the tab itself, the full text is 
shown in the hint.

2009-01-13 Thread Maurice Snellen
On Tuesday, January 13, 2009 at 10:26 Mau wrote:

 Meanwhile, can you copypaste one of your filters to take a look?

That's a bit complicated as they are on my work computer and I read this
list on my home computer.

 Incoming filter, or perhaps a simple on that would move all virus
 reports to a single physical folder and then create virtual folders
 for each virus.

I've considered that, but it wouldn't make things work the way I want
to. First of all, we're talking about more than 500.000 virus report
messages at any given time. I'm not sure what the performance of several
hundred virtual folders would be in that case.

Moreover, if a virtual folder no longer lists any messages and I delete
it, how would I be triggered to recreate that folder?

Worse still, how would I be able to find out what virtual folders to
create to start with? Currently that is quite easy. I have a master
filter that matches any messages coming from the av application. I look
at messages and create a filter, then I re-filter the folder and I am
left with the messages that still need to be filtered to separate
folders. I can continue doing this until no messages are left.

As soon as messages stay in the av application folder, I know that I
need to make new filters.
